Temple City, California Gum Disease Treatment: Services at Every Stage of Disease

Whether you are in the early stages of gum disease or have been dealing with periodontitis for years, dental professionals in Temple City, CA offer treatment services calibrated to your specific condition. Here is how gum disease treatment in Temple City, California is structured across disease stages:

  1. Stage I — Gingivitis Management: Professional cleaning and personalized oral hygiene instruction. If you are in this stage, you are fortunate — gingivitis is fully reversible, and the cost of treatment is low. Available at every dental office in Temple City.
  2. Stage II/III — Non-Surgical Periodontal Therapy: Scaling and root planing, performed over multiple appointments with local anesthesia, is the cornerstone of gum disease treatment in Temple City, CA for patients with mild to moderate periodontitis. Most Temple City general dentists offer this service, and outcomes for patients who complete the full protocol and transition to quarterly maintenance are excellent.
  3. Antibiotic Adjuncts: For patients with moderate-to-deep pockets (5mm or more), locally delivered antibiotics placed after scaling and root planing enhance outcomes. Available at most Temple City dental practices offering periodontal treatment.
  4. Re-Evaluation and Decision Point: Six to eight weeks after completing scaling and root planing, your Temple City dentist re-measures all pockets to assess the healing response. Most patients show significant improvement. Those with persistent deep pockets may be referred for surgical consultation.
  5. Periodontal Surgery (Via Referral): Board-certified periodontists serving the Temple City, California and County area provide the full range of surgical periodontics for patients who require it.
  6. Periodontal Maintenance (For Life): Three-to-four-month professional cleaning cycles, available at Temple City dental offices, form the ongoing treatment foundation after active therapy. This is the stage most Temple City periodontal patients will remain in indefinitely.

Here is a practical framework for managing periodontal treatment costs in Temple City, California:

Understanding Your Insurance: If you have dental insurance that includes periodontal benefits, most plans cover 50–80% of non-surgical treatment (scaling and root planing) after the deductible, up to your annual maximum. Before your appointment, ask your Temple City dental office to submit a pre-authorization to your insurer so you know exactly what your out-of-pocket responsibility will be.

Strategies for Uninsured Temple City Residents:

  1. HRSA Health Centers: Locate the nearest federally qualified health center serving Temple City and County at findahealthcenter.hrsa.gov. Fees are based on your income — many patients pay $20–$40 per visit.
  2. Dental School Clinics: Call dental schools within a reasonable drive of Temple City, California to inquire about periodontal treatment availability. Expect 40–70% cost reduction versus private practice rates.
  3. In-House Dental Plans: Ask Temple City dental offices about membership plans that provide access to care at reduced rates for an annual fee.
  4. Financing: CareCredit and Sunbit offer 0% promotional financing at many Temple City, CA dental offices for qualified applicants.

How long does gum disease treatment take in Temple City, California?

The timeline for gum disease treatment in Temple City, CA depends on the severity of your disease and the specific treatments required. Here is a realistic timeline for the most common treatment pathway in Temple City: Week 1 — Initial periodontal evaluation and treatment planning. Weeks 2–4 — Scaling and root planing appointments, typically one or two quadrants per visit, scheduled one to two weeks apart. Most Temple City patients complete active treatment in two to four appointments over three to six weeks. Weeks 6–8 — Critical re-evaluation appointment. Your Temple City dentist measures all pockets again to assess healing and determine whether additional treatment (including possible surgical referral to a County periodontist) is needed. Months 3, 6, 9, 12 onward — Periodontal maintenance visits every three months. This ongoing schedule continues indefinitely and is the foundation of preventing gum disease recurrence. The active treatment phase for most Temple City residents is four to eight weeks. The maintenance phase is lifelong. What are the most effective home care practices to support gum disease treatment in Temple City, California?

Maximizing the results of professional gum disease treatment in Temple City, CA requires a strong daily home care commitment between dental appointments. Your Temple City dentist or hygienist will provide personalized guidance, but the evidence-based home care practices recommended for Temple City periodontal patients include: brushing thoroughly twice daily (morning and before bed) with a soft-bristled toothbrush and fluoride toothpaste, spending at least two minutes per session and giving special attention to the gumline where bacteria accumulate; cleaning between teeth daily using floss, interdental brushes (particularly effective for patients with larger pockets or implants), or an oral irrigator/water flosser — ask your Temple City dental provider which is most appropriate for your specific pocket depths; rinsing twice daily with a prescribed antimicrobial mouth rinse if your Temple City dentist has recommended one; quitting tobacco immediately — smoking is the single largest risk factor for treatment failure and disease recurrence, and patients who smoke after periodontal treatment have significantly worse long-term outcomes than non-smokers; managing systemic conditions like diabetes, which when poorly controlled dramatically accelerates bone loss associated with gum disease; and attending every scheduled maintenance appointment at your Temple City dental office — even when you feel fine. Home care and professional treatment work together; neither is sufficient without the other.
